    Japan’s Kyushu Electric to wait for US LNG policy clarity on Lake Charles | Reuters News Agency


    Energy

    Reuters exclusively reported that Japan’s Kyushu Electric Power will wait until after the United States resumes issuing export licenses for new liquefied natural gas (LNG) projects before deciding on whether to invest in the Lake Charles project. 

    Market Impact

    Japan is the world’s second-biggest LNG importer after China. Before Biden’s freeze, Kyushu Electric had said it was considering investing in the project, among others, to secure LNG supplies.
